Here are the requirements of voucher taking schools:

FloridaChild will award scholarships to help children attend any nonpublic school that wishes to admit them, provided that the school is located in Florida, offers an education to students in any grades K-12, and meets the following conditions:

a. Complies with the antidiscrimination provisions of 42 U.S.C. s. 2000d.
b. Meets state and local health and safety laws and codes.
c. Complies with all state laws relating to the general regulation of nonpublic schools.
d. Demonstrates fiscal soundness by being in operation for one school year, or provides the Florida Department of Education with a statement by a certified public accountant confirming that the nonpublic school is insured and the owner or owners have sufficient capital or credit to operate the school for the upcoming year serving the number of students anticipated with expected revenues from tuition and other sources that may be reasonably expected. In lieu of such a statement, a surety bond or letter of credit for the amount equal to the scholarship funds for any quarter may be filed with the Department.
